Gruffudd for Bond role?
Published Saturday, Nov 20 2004, 15:20 GMT | By Daniel Kilkelly
Welsh actor Ioan Gruffudd is the latest star rumoured to be taking over the role of James Bond.
Following Pierce Brosnan's axing from the role, rumours have suggested that actors including Jude Law, Colin Firth and Ewan McGregor could be replacing him.
However, Gruffudd, who starred in King Arthur is said to be in talks with producers about taking over as Bond for the next movie. He is currently in the US filming The Fantastic Four.
